Acupuncture and Laser Therapy for AC Joint and Top-of-Shoulder Pain in Lakewood Ranch

Quick Answer: Can acupuncture or laser therapy help AC joint pain?

Acupuncture and low-level laser therapy may help selected, appropriately evaluated patients manage pain, muscle guarding, or activity limitations around the acromioclavicular (AC) joint, but neither is a guaranteed cure or a substitute for diagnosing the cause. The AC joint sits at the top of the shoulder where the collarbone meets the shoulder blade. Pain there may follow a fall, repetitive pressing or reaching, arthritis, ligament injury, or another shoulder condition. A visible deformity after trauma, inability to lift the arm, a cold or numb hand, chest symptoms, fever, or rapidly increasing swelling needs prompt medical evaluation rather than routine pain-relief treatment.

What Are the Key Facts About AC Joint Pain?

  • The AC joint is the small joint at the top of the shoulder where the clavicle meets the acromion.
  • Typical pain is focal and may worsen when reaching across the body, pressing overhead, sleeping on that side, or carrying a bag.
  • Common causes include osteoarthritis, ligament sprain or separation, distal clavicle stress, and repetitive loading.
  • Rotator cuff, neck, nerve, fracture, infection, inflammatory arthritis, and referred medical problems can mimic AC joint pain.
  • A new bump after a fall may represent an AC separation; the degree of deformity does not by itself determine the full treatment plan.
  • Acupuncture and low-level laser therapy may support symptom and function goals for some patients, although evidence specific to every AC joint condition is limited.
  • Exercise and gradual load management often matter because passive care alone does not restore shoulder capacity.

What is the AC joint, and why can it hurt?

The acromioclavicular joint is a small, nearly flat joint between the outer end of the collarbone and a projection of the shoulder blade called the acromion. Ligaments stabilize it, and a capsule surrounds it. Although the joint moves only a little, it helps the shoulder blade and collarbone coordinate as the arm rises, reaches, pushes, and carries.

Its position makes it easy to identify but also easy to load. A direct fall onto the shoulder can stretch or tear its supporting ligaments. Years of pressing, lifting, contact sports, overhead work, or ordinary aging may change the joint surfaces. Weightlifters can develop stress-related irritation at the outer clavicle. Some people have imaging changes without pain, so an X-ray finding alone does not prove the source.

Pain can come from the joint, surrounding ligaments, bone, or nearby tissues. That is why β€œtop-of-shoulder pain” is a location, not a complete diagnosis.

What does AC joint pain usually feel like?

People often point with one finger to the top of the shoulder. The area may be tender where the collarbone ends, and pain can spread a short distance into the upper trapezius or outer shoulder. Reaching across the chest to fasten a seat belt, apply sunscreen, or touch the opposite shoulder may reproduce it.

Bench pressing, push-ups, dips, overhead presses, serving in tennis, sleeping directly on the shoulder, or carrying a heavy suitcase may also hurt. Arthritis can produce an ache, stiffness, grinding, or a prominent bump. An acute sprain may create sharp pain, swelling, bruising, and reluctance to move the arm.

Symptoms are not perfectly specific. Rotator cuff pain often appears farther down the outer arm, while neck-related symptoms may include tingling or pain below the elbow, but overlap is common. Examination and history matter more than one provocative movement.

What causes pain at the top of the shoulder?

AC osteoarthritis becomes more common with age and previous injury. Cartilage changes and bone spurs may narrow the joint, yet many such changes are painless. Symptoms should match the history and examination before arthritis is treated as the answer.

An AC sprain or separation usually follows a direct impact, such as falling from a bicycle, landing on the shoulder during sports, or slipping on a wet surface. Ligament injury ranges from mild tenderness without deformity to substantial displacement. Distal clavicle osteolysis is a stress-related problem associated with repeated heavy pressing or overhead load, although other bone conditions must be considered.

Less common but important causes include fracture, infection, inflammatory arthritis, tumor, or pain referred from the neck, chest, lungs, gallbladder, or heart. A clinician should also assess the rotator cuff, biceps tendon, labrum, and shoulder blade mechanics rather than assuming every tender AC joint is the sole problem.

Which shoulder symptoms need urgent or emergency care?

Seek prompt evaluation after a significant fall or collision when there is an obvious step-off or deformity, severe swelling, inability to use the arm, marked collarbone tenderness, an open wound, or suspected dislocation or fracture. A hand that becomes cold, pale, blue, weak, or numb can indicate nerve or circulation compromise and requires urgent care.

Call 911 for shoulder discomfort accompanied by chest pressure, shortness of breath, sweating, fainting, nausea, or pain spreading to the jaw or arm, especially when symptoms are new or occur with exertion. Shoulder pain can occasionally be referred from a cardiac or pulmonary problem rather than the joint.

Fever, redness, unusual warmth, rapidly increasing swelling, drainage, or severe pain with very limited motion may suggest infection. New weakness after trauma, progressive neurologic symptoms, unexplained weight loss, persistent night pain unrelated to position, or a history of cancer also warrants timely medical assessment. Acupuncture or laser therapy should not delay that evaluation.

How is suspected AC joint pain evaluated?

Evaluation begins with the mechanism, timing, exact location, dominant arm, work and sport demands, previous injury, and symptoms from the neck through the hand. A clinician may inspect for bruising, swelling, asymmetry, muscle loss, or a prominent distal clavicle, then compare motion, strength, sensation, circulation, and tenderness.

Cross-body adduction and other focused tests can load the AC joint, but no single test is definitive. Rotator cuff strength, shoulder blade motion, neck movement, and neurologic findings help identify overlapping sources. A temporary diagnostic anesthetic injection may sometimes help a qualified medical professional clarify the pain generator, but that is an individualized decision.

X-rays can show alignment, fracture, arthritis, and distal clavicle changes. Ultrasound may assess the rotator cuff and guide selected procedures. MRI can provide more detail about ligaments, bone, rotator cuff, labrum, and other tissues when the result would change management. Imaging is not automatically required for every mild, improving presentation.

How do common top-of-shoulder pain patterns compare?

Possible patternCommon cluesWhy evaluation matters
AC joint arthritisFocal top-of-shoulder ache, tenderness, cross-body pain, possible bump or grindingImaging changes can exist without symptoms
AC sprain or separationDirect fall, immediate pain, swelling, bruising, or new step-offFracture, dislocation, and injury grade may affect the plan
Rotator cuff conditionPain with lifting or rotation, outer-arm pain, weakness, painful sleepA substantial tear or another shoulder disorder may need different care
Neck or nerve referralNeck pain, tingling, numbness, symptoms below the elbow, position-related changesProgressive weakness or spinal cord signs require timely assessment
Distal clavicle stress injuryPain linked to repetitive bench press, push-ups, dips, or heavy overhead workBone stress, training load, and alternative causes should be reviewed
Referred or systemic problemChest, breathing, abdominal, fever, systemic, or nonmechanical symptomsThe shoulder may not be the primary source

Can acupuncture help AC joint pain?

Acupuncture uses thin, sterile needles at selected points. Proposed effects include changes in pain processing, local and central nervous-system signaling, and muscle tone. Research on acupuncture for shoulder pain suggests that some patients may experience symptom or function improvement, but studies include different diagnoses and treatment methods. Evidence focused only on AC arthritis or separation is comparatively limited.

After appropriate screening, acupuncture may be considered as an adjunct for pain, guarding, or movement tolerance. Needle placement does not need to be directly into an irritated joint, and treatment should account for skin condition, infection risk, bleeding risk, altered sensation, and relevant medical history.

Response should be tracked with meaningful tasks: putting on a shirt, sleeping, reaching a shelf, carrying groceries, or returning to a modified golf swing. Temporary relaxation after a session is not the same as restored capacity. Worsening deformity, weakness, neurologic symptoms, or loss of function calls for reassessment.

Can low-level laser therapy help the AC joint?

Low-level laser therapy, also called photobiomodulation, applies controlled light energy and is different from a surgical laser. Proposed mechanisms involve cellular signaling and modulation of inflammatory and pain processes. Research across shoulder conditions is mixed and depends on diagnosis, wavelength, energy, treatment location, and study design.

For a stable, evaluated condition, laser therapy may be considered as one part of a broader plan. It cannot realign a separated joint, repair a torn ligament on contact, erase arthritis, or guarantee avoidance of surgery. Device-specific precautions, protective eyewear, skin inspection, medical history, and an accurate treatment target matter.

Laser should not be placed over suspected infection, an unexplained mass, active bleeding, or an unassessed acute injury. A time-limited trial with baseline function and review points is more responsible than continuing indefinitely without measurable progress.

How are AC joint sprains and separations managed?

Management depends on injury severity, timing, arm demands, symptoms, and patient goals. Many lower-grade injuries are treated without surgery using temporary protection, symptom control, gradual motion, and progressive strengthening. A sling may be used briefly in some cases, but prolonged immobilization can contribute to stiffness and weakness.

More substantial separations deserve orthopedic evaluation, especially when there is marked displacement, high physical demand, skin pressure, persistent pain, or uncertainty about associated injury. Some higher-grade injuries are still managed nonoperatively, while others may be considered for surgery. A visible bump can remain even when function improves.

Acupuncture or laser therapy cannot replace fracture evaluation, ligament grading, or surgical consultation when indicated. If used, it should support comfort and participation in an appropriate rehabilitation pathway rather than obscure worsening signs.

What role does exercise play in AC joint recovery?

Exercise helps restore comfortable motion, rotator cuff capacity, shoulder blade control, and tolerance for pushing, pulling, lifting, or sport. The starting point should fit irritability. Early work may involve comfortable assisted motion and low-load muscle activation, followed by gradual resistance and task-specific progression.

Repeated deep horizontal pressing, dips, heavy bench press, end-range cross-body stretching, or painful overhead work may need temporary modification. That does not mean every shoulder requires complete rest. Removing all load for too long can reduce capacity without solving why a task became intolerable.

Progress is better guided by symptom behavior and function than by a fixed online calendar. Pain that settles and does not progressively worsen can differ from increasing night pain, swelling, weakness, or declining motion. An exercise plan should change when the diagnosis or response changes.

How can gym exercises be modified without losing all progress?

For an evaluated, stable presentation, some people tolerate a narrower pressing grip, a shorter range, neutral-grip dumbbells, landmine pressing, cable work, or lower resistance better than deep bench press or dips. Those are examples, not prescriptions. Technique, injury severity, equipment, and individual anatomy change what is appropriate.

Lower-body training, walking, and other nonprovocative conditioning may continue when safe, helping preserve routine while the shoulder plan develops. Heavy bars resting directly over a tender joint, sudden volume increases, and repeatedly testing painful maximums can prolong irritation.

A useful return-to-loading plan records resistance, repetitions, range, discomfort during the session, and the response later that day and the next morning. The goal is not to avoid every sensation; it is to build capacity without a pattern of escalating pain or lost function.

Can posture or shoulder blade mechanics cause AC pain?

Shoulder blade position and movement influence how forces travel through the collarbone and shoulder, but posture is rarely a complete explanation. There is no single perfect posture that prevents pain. Many people with rounded shoulders have no symptoms, and forcing the chest up all day can create unnecessary tension.

Movement variety, strength, and task setup may matter more than holding one rigid pose. For desk work, alternating positions can reduce repeated strain. In sport, trunk and shoulder blade control may help distribute load.

Posture advice should not distract from acute trauma, arthritis, bone stress, or another diagnosis.

Do ice, heat, braces, or medicine solve AC joint pain?

Brief cooling may provide temporary comfort after an acute aggravation. Heat may feel useful for surrounding stiffness in a stable condition. Protect the skin and avoid either method when sensation or circulation is impaired. Neither approach repairs a ligament or identifies the diagnosis.

AC supports, taping, or a sling can help selected patients for limited periods, but fit and duration matter. Tight straps may irritate skin or compress sensitive structures. Long immobilization can increase stiffness. A new traumatic deformity should be assessed before relying on a brace.

Over-the-counter medicines are not risk-free. Kidney disease, ulcers, anticoagulants, heart conditions, allergies, pregnancy, and other medicines can change safety. Medication choice and dosing should be discussed with an appropriate clinician or pharmacist; this article does not provide an individual regimen.

When is an injection or surgical referral considered?

A qualified medical clinician may discuss an image-guided or landmark-guided injection for selected, confirmed AC joint pain when conservative measures have not provided adequate function. Potential benefits, temporary effects, infection risk, blood glucose considerations, tissue effects, medicines, and diagnostic uncertainty should be reviewed individually.

Referral may be appropriate for a significant acute separation, fracture, persistent instability, distal clavicle stress injury, substantial functional loss, or symptoms that remain limiting despite a well-structured plan. Surgery for symptomatic arthritis may involve removing a small portion of the distal clavicle in selected cases. That decision requires diagnosis, imaging context, goals, and specialist discussion.

Passive treatments should not become a reason to postpone referral when objective weakness, deformity, neurologic change, or persistent major limitation is present.

What should Lakewood Ranch, Bradenton, and Sarasota residents consider?

Local recreation often keeps shoulders busy year-round. Golf creates cross-body and rotational loads; pickleball and tennis add repeated reaching; swimming and strength classes add overhead volume. A sudden increase in rounds, matches, laps, or pressing load may matter more than any single movement.

Seasonal yard work, lifting storm supplies, moving patio furniture, and carrying luggage through Sarasota-Bradenton International Airport can expose a sensitive AC joint. Long drives on I-75 may also make neck and shoulder symptoms overlap. Breaking tasks into smaller loads and varying positions can help, but a traumatic injury or neurologic symptom still needs assessment.

Florida heat can affect fatigue and training tolerance, but dehydration does not explain every shoulder pain. Plan demanding activity during cooler hours when possible, follow personal fluid restrictions, and avoid using heat-related assumptions to dismiss chest symptoms, weakness, or an acute injury.

What should a measured care plan include?

First, establish a working diagnosis and screen for trauma, fracture, deformity, infection, neurologic compromise, and referred medical causes. Baseline measures may include pain location, sleep tolerance, motion, strength, cross-body reach, carrying ability, and a personally important task.

Next, reduce or modify the loads that repeatedly provoke the joint while maintaining safe activity. Add progressive motion and strength work appropriate to the condition. Acupuncture or low-level laser therapy may be included when clinically suitable, but each should have a defined goal and review point.

If function does not improve, symptoms worsen, or the pattern changes, reconsider imaging, medical workup, rehabilitation strategy, or specialist referral. Good care adapts to evidence rather than repeating the same treatment by habit.

What are common questions about AC joint pain?

Is a bump on top of the shoulder always an AC separation?

No. Arthritis can create a gradual prominence, while injury can cause a new step-off. A new bump after trauma, especially with pain or limited use, should be evaluated for separation or fracture.

Can AC joint arthritis show on an X-ray without causing pain?

Yes. Imaging changes are common and may not match symptoms. The history, location, examination, and response to targeted care help determine whether the joint is clinically relevant.

Can acupuncture put a separated AC joint back in place?

No. Acupuncture does not realign displaced bones or repair torn ligaments mechanically. It may support selected symptom goals after appropriate injury assessment.

Can laser therapy remove an AC joint bone spur?

No. Low-level laser therapy does not remove bone. It may be considered for symptom support in selected cases, but no structural or pain-free result should be promised.

Should I stop all upper-body exercise?

Not necessarily. Stable, evaluated conditions often allow modified ranges, resistance, or exercise selection. Acute trauma, deformity, marked weakness, or worsening symptoms changes the plan.

Why does reaching across my body hurt?

Cross-body movement compresses and loads the AC joint, so it can reproduce local symptoms. The test is not perfectly specific, and rotator cuff or other shoulder problems may overlap.

Can I sleep on the painful shoulder?

Direct pressure may aggravate symptoms. Temporary position changes or pillow support may improve comfort, but persistent severe night pain or non-positional pain deserves evaluation.

How long does AC joint pain take to improve?

There is no universal timeline. Cause, injury grade, symptom duration, activity demands, health, and response to rehabilitation all matter. Functional review points are more useful than a promised deadline.

What is the bottom line?

AC joint pain is often felt directly at the top of the shoulder, particularly with cross-body reach, pressing, carrying, or side sleeping. Arthritis, sprain, separation, bone stress, rotator cuff conditions, neck referral, and less common medical problems can overlap. Trauma with deformity, circulation or nerve changes, chest symptoms, fever, or major loss of function requires timely medical care.

For a stable, properly evaluated condition, load modification and progressive movement and strength usually provide the foundation. Acupuncture and low-level laser therapy may support pain or function for selected patients, but they do not realign a separation, remove a bone spur, or guarantee recovery. Progress should be measured, and imaging or referral should be used when the clinical pattern calls for it.
